| From the neck of an amphora. Tongue pattern from base of neck, alternately red and black. On the shoulder, wreathed head, right; branch at left; at right, spear of wheat and oblique line close to break ... 5 April 1949 |
| Section of heavy ring foot and floor preserved. In medallion framed by single line, a youthful satyr, standing right. In field at left, a staff(?) or thyrsos.
Glaze on inner edge and top of ring foot ... 5 April 1949 |
| About half of a Type B skyphos, with the vertical handle preserved. The ring foot and space within reserved. Glaze band on inner face of foot; circle and dot within.
Firm black glaze, somewhat mottled ... 1949 |
| Fragment from the floor of a stemless cup; low flat base, reserved beneath. Part of a nude figure seated on a couch and reclining against cushions. Published as plate fragment (PK). Found going through ... 1949 |
| Two fragments from flat-topped straight-walled pyxis lid. Groove, reserved, around rim on top. On the wall, part of a door; and Erotes at play; the upper part of one figure preserved, bending over, holding ... 1949 |
